Output af123a224fc36042263098079189abb1af04386b52a66e3ec6132f8bcd4b0d63:0

value
3369479
script pubkey
OP_0 OP_PUSHBYTES_32 ae027c3fb8cfa03cfd947f1b60d57f5c9eeec8643bf297cdb070fffe2c90cd11
address
bc1q4cp8c0ace7srelv50udkp4tltj0wajry80ef0ndswrllutyse5gs30agdg
transaction
af123a224fc36042263098079189abb1af04386b52a66e3ec6132f8bcd4b0d63
spent
true